Template:Kart-infobox The Blue Seven is an unlockable kart part in Mario Kart 7. As its name states, it's a blue car with the number "7" imprinted on its spoiler. It has a white stripe running through its hood and the character insignia imprinted on the sides of the car. It contains headlights and backlights which illuminate in darker areas. The Blue Seven offers a speed and weight boost, while hindering acceleration and handling.

Stat boosts

  • Speed: +0.5
  • Acceleration: -0.5
  • Weight: +0.25
  • Handling: -0.25
  • Off-Road: 0
